What should I do before I travel?

Before you travel, obtain a physical Afghan visa in advance. The visa application must be made at an Afghan embassy or consulate; Afghanistan has no embassy in Lithuania and the nearest Afghan embassy noted for this route is in India.

Ensure your passport is valid for at least six months beyond your planned date of entry. Carry your passport as the required travel document.

Although not required for entry, arranging travel insurance is recommended.

What happens at the border?

A physical visa granted in advance by an Afghan embassy or consulate is the required permission to enter Afghanistan for Lithuanian travellers. The visa’s period of validity varies by case.

No arrival registration or entry card is recorded as required for this route in the provided facts.

Frequently asked questions

Do I need a visa to visit Afghanistan?

Lithuanian citizens require a physical visa to enter Afghanistan for tourism. You must apply and obtain that visa before travel.

Can I get the Afghan visa on arrival or do I have to get it beforehand?

The visa for Afghanistan must be a physical visa obtained in advance at an Afghan embassy or consulate. You cannot obtain it on arrival.

How long must my passport be valid for travel to Afghanistan?

You must hold an ordinary passport valid for at least 6 months beyond your date of entry into Afghanistan.

What travel document do I need for Afghanistan?

You must present a passport as your travel document; a passport is the accepted document for entry to Afghanistan.

Do I need any vaccinations before going to Afghanistan?

No vaccinations are recorded as required or recommended for Lithuanian travellers to Afghanistan in the provided facts.

Do I need travel insurance to enter Afghanistan?

Travel insurance is recommended for travel to Afghanistan but it is not a condition of entry according to the provided facts.
